ERROR! The server quit without updating PID file (/usr/local/mysql/data/192.168.1.26.pid).
时间: 2024-01-23 07:15:27 浏览: 97
这个错误通常是由于MySQL无法更新PID文件而导致的。PID文件是一个包含MySQL进程ID的文件,用于跟踪MySQL进程的运行状态。当MySQL启动时,它会尝试更新PID文件,但如果出现问题,就会出现这个错误。
解决这个问题的方法有几种:
1. 检查文件权限:确保MySQL用户对PID文件所在的目录具有写入权限。可以使用以下命令更改目录权限:
```shell
sudo chmod 777 /usr/local/mysql/data/
```
2. 检查文件所有者和组:确保PID文件的所有者和组与MySQL用户匹配。可以使用以下命令更改文件所有者和组:
```shell
sudo chown mysql:mysql /usr/local/mysql/data/192.168.1.26.pid
```
3. 删除PID文件:如果PID文件已经存在,可以尝试删除它并重新启动MySQL。可以使用以下命令删除PID文件:
```shell
sudo rm /usr/local/mysql/data/192.168.1.26.pid
```
4. 检查MySQL配置文件:检查MySQL配置文件中的PID文件路径是否正确。可以使用以下命令编辑配置文件:
```shell
sudo vi /etc/my.cnf
```
在配置文件中找到`pid-file`选项,并确保其值与实际PID文件的路径匹配。
5. 检查MySQL日志:查看MySQL错误日志以获取更多详细信息。可以使用以下命令打开错误日志文件:
```shell
sudo vi /var/log/mysql/error.log
```
在日志文件中查找与PID文件相关的错误消息,以确定导致问题的原因。
阅读全文